New cadets are attending academic briefings today and receiving information on their classes and schedules for the academic year. Members of the Dean’s team from the Registrar’s office, academic counselors and Instructors will be available for questions during this sessions. This is Company C. They are holding a copy of their tentative schedule.

As we get ready to cheer on the 122nd annual Army-Navy game, here’s a spirit spot featuring proud parents of a former Sea Cadet now a Junior (Cow) at the U.S. Military Academy at West Point. Cadet Ezra Gavilan was chosen to participate in this spirit spot for his professionalism, military bearing, and dedication. He is joined by his mother Chey Gavilan and her husband, Rafael Gavilan, a 1984 graduate of West Point. U.S. Naval Sea Cadet Corps is a nation-wide youth organization for young men and women ages 10 to 17 providing unique and valuable experiences that incorporate hands on learning and teamwork in the sea services For more information about the U.S. Naval Sea Cadet Corps, visit www.seacadets.org.
